Course Content

• Cloud Computing Fundamentals for Dispute Resolution
• Data Security and Privacy in Cloud-Based Arbitration
• Blockchain Technology and Smart Contracts in Arbitration
• Cloud-Based Evidence Management and eDiscovery
• Online Dispute Resolution (ODR) Platforms and Technologies
• AI and Machine Learning in Arbitration: Applications and Challenges
• Implementing Cloud Solutions for International Arbitration
• Legal and Ethical Considerations of Cloud Computing in Dispute Resolution
